  • Patent number: 10985303
    Abstract: A thermally efficient, cost efficient and compact LED device having an LED module and a circuit board. The LED module having an LED substrate and an LED chip mounted on a mounting surface of the LED substrate. The circuit board is composed of a circuit board substrate and has a plurality of conductive tracks on a surface of the circuit board substrate. The LED substrate is embedded in the circuit board substrate.

  • Patent number: 10734364
    Abstract: A lighting arrangement includes at least a first and a second LED lighting element arranged next to each other on a carrier surface. The spacer element has, at least in a portion thereof which is in contact with the second LED lighting element, a width which is less than 20% of a width of the first LED lighting element. The first LED lighting element comprises a spacer element projecting into a direction in parallel to the carrier surface. The second LED lighting element is arranged in contact with the spacer element such that it is arranged aligned relative to the first LED lighting element, and such that the first and second LED lighting elements are arranged at a distance forming a gap between the first and second LED lighting elements.

  • Patent number: 10253938
    Abstract: A lighting arrangement 10 is described with an LED element 30. A reference frame part 14 comprises a frame opening 26 bordered by frame edges 28a, 28b, 28c, 28d. The LED element 30 is arranged such that light is emitted through the frame opening 26 and is partially shielded at least at a first frame edge 28b. The reference frame part further comprises reference portions 20a, 20b, 20c, 20d to define positions relative to the frame 5 opening. A first reference portion 20a, 20b is provided on a first surface portion of the reference frame part 14 arranged parallel to a light emitting surface 38 of the LED element 30. A second reference portion 20c is arranged on a second surface portion of the reference frame part 14 arranged perpendicular to the first surface portion. A third reference portion 20d is arranged on a third surface portion of the reference frame part 14 arranged 10 perpendicular to both the first and second surface portions.
